This weekend I noticed that my front camera lens is broken! It has a couple nice cracks through it. It still works, but the cracks make the image look dirty. I don't see ANY evidence of an impact. It looks like moisture inside and I'm assuming it froze - breaking the lens.

Anyone else had this issue? It's going into the dealer on Thursday for this and a couple other things.

This is a 2012 with 35,500 miles.

Sooo... current status

Dealer hasn't addressed camera lens, but I have a feeling they're going to blame it on dumb luck and say no warranty.

Dealer says weird shock noises are normal, read a bulletin from Ford about it

Dealer says valve cover oil is due to the AFE - poor quality hose, oil soaking through it, but nothing else wrong.
